Hi @rosieanna. I assume you and your husband live together? Unfortunately unless you also claim a qualifying benefit e.g. PIP/DLA/AA then he won't be entitled to SDP. The criteria for this is that there can be no other adult living in the house (unless they get a qualifying benefit) and no-one claims Carer's Allowance for them.0
